Clinical safety, patient privacy and device classification

Health

Anything that informs care carries a clinical risk-management duty and a privacy duty at the same time. We determine device classification early, build the hazard log and safety case alongside delivery, and specify clinician oversight at every point where a model output can reach a patient pathway.

Clinical safety

Clinical risk management and post-market surveillance apply wherever a system informs care.

Patient privacy

PHIPA, HIPAA and equivalent regimes govern secondary use, de-identification and cross-border flows.

Device classification

Some tools are software as a medical device; that determination must be made early and documented.
